Question 475: To ask the Minister for Communications, Energy and Natural Resources if he will provide licences for draft net salmon fishing for small boats at a location (details supplied) on a river; and if he will make a statement on the matter. [35928/10]

Photo of Eamon RyanEamon Ryan (Dublin South, Green Party)
Link to this: Individually | In context

In the case of bays and estuaries into which two or more rivers flow, the expert advice requires that all impacted rivers are meeting their conservation limits before harvest of salmon stocks is permitted.

At present, the published assessment in respect of the common estuary in Lough Swilly indicates that the rivers Mill, Swilly and Lennan are not meeting their conservation limits. Accordingly, for conservation reasons, the harvest of fish is not permissible in the area referred to by the Deputy.

The status of the stocks of salmon rivers is reviewed annually.
